Dart custom annotations
WebJan 14, 2024 · Annotations on method and URL parameters decide how the request will be handled. Every method must have HTTP annotation and relative parameters. There are built-in annotations like GET, PUT,... WebTo use an experiment with Dart SDK command line tools , pass the corresponding flag to the tool. For example, to enable the experiments super-mixins and no-slow-checks , add those flags to the dart command: $ dart run --enable-experiment=super-mixins,no-slow-checks bin/main.dart Using experiment flags with the Dart analyzer (command-line and …
Dart custom annotations
Did you know?
Web2.3K views 6 years ago Dart Computer Programming for Intermediates Annotations are metadata - data that describes other data. For example, if you have a picture, the jpeg file is the data, but... WebDec 8, 2024 · Every method must have HTTP annotation and relative parameters. There are some built-in annotations like GET, PUT, POST, PATCH, DELETE & HEADER. Add methods with annotations in ApiClient like...
WebJan 29, 2024 · Inspired by json2typescript, serde, gson, feature parity with highly popular Java Jackson and only 4 annotations to remember to cover all possible use cases. No extra boilerplate, no messy extra *.g.dart files per each meaningful file (single root-level file which contains all of the generated code) WebFeb 28, 2024 · pizza_topping_data.dart PizzaMenu A simple class that provides a map of PizzaToppingData objects via the getPizzaToppingsDataMap() method for the pizza toppings selection in UI.
WebFeb 4, 2014 · The annotation support in Dart happens only via external packages like build_runner and/or code_gen. There is no native support for annotations in Dart. – Mike Mitterer Jan 23, 2024 at 13:09 1 Dart supports metadata which is used to attach user defined annotations to program structures. WebDart Learn how to do type annotations in Dart using typedefs.. Typedef is an alias for creating variables of New Types or instances of Function objects. typedefs can be used to achieve type annotations. Typedef allows you to do the following new things Create a variable of new types similar to a normal variable declaration
WebThe Dart language is type safe: it uses a combination of static type checking and runtime checks to ensure that a variable’s value always matches the variable’s static type, sometimes referred to as sound typing. Although types are mandatory, type annotations are optional because of type inference.
WebApr 14, 2024 · Swagger 3 @Operation annotation. In Swagger 3, the @Operation annotation is used to provide metadata for a single API operation.. Here’s an example of how the @Operation annotation can be used in Spring Boot:. public class TutorialController { @Operation( summary = "Retrieve a Tutorial by Id", description = "Get a Tutorial object … lits flight travel agents in alabamaWebThe specification of a custom annotation. Inheritance. Object; Annotation; FigureAnnotation; CustomAnnotation; Constructors CustomAnnotation ({required List < … lits froidsWebDart supports generic types, like List (a list of integers) or List (a list of objects of any type). Dart supports top-level functions (such as main()), as well as …WebNov 22, 2024 · 1 Answer Sorted by: 12 If I got you right, you want to decorate library's class with your own. You can use @JsonKey annotation to set functions for (en)decoding library's Address object.WebNov 9, 2014 · custom annotation / Metadata in dart lang. Can any one explain me the use of annotations in Dart? library todo; class todo { final String who; final String what; const …WebApr 14, 2024 · Swagger 3 @Operation annotation. In Swagger 3, the @Operation annotation is used to provide metadata for a single API operation.. Here’s an example …WebDO type annotate variables without initializers. DO type annotate fields and top-level variables if the type isn’t obvious. DON’T redundantly type annotate initialized local variables. DO annotate return types on function declarations. DO annotate parameter types on function declarations.WebJun 6, 2024 · The first step toward creating a custom annotation is to declare it using the @interface keyword: public @interface JsonSerializable { } Copy The next step is to add meta-annotations to specify the scope and the target of our custom annotation: @Retention (RetentionPolicy.RUNTIME) @Target (ElementType.Type) public …Web2.3K views 6 years ago Dart Computer Programming for Intermediates Annotations are metadata - data that describes other data. For example, if you have a picture, the jpeg file is the data, but...WebAug 16, 2024 · Basic JSON annotations Freezed supports many annotations that let us customize how the code generator processes our models. The most useful ones are @JsonKey and @Default. Here's an example of how I'm … lits froids stationsWebGet in on the Fun with Dartboards & Darts Scoring Shop dartboards for sale from DICK'S Sporting Goods. Browse all electronic dartboards and bristle dartboards from top-rated … lits gauthierWebJul 18, 2024 · But perhaps i have found the answer inside the meta package - in meta-meta.dart - to be precise. As I understand, you can annotate your custom annotation class (annotation definition, not the annotated elements) with @Target (targets) where targets is a Set where TargetKind is an enum. litsh764nwWebAnnotations that developers can use to express the intentions that otherwise can't be deduced by statically analyzing the source code. See also @deprecated and @override … lits hamilton collegeWebJun 6, 2024 · The first step toward creating a custom annotation is to declare it using the @interface keyword: public @interface JsonSerializable { } Copy The next step is to add meta-annotations to specify the scope and the target of our custom annotation: @Retention (RetentionPolicy.RUNTIME) @Target (ElementType.Type) public … lit shadow box